The best pizza outside of a very few in NYC Fiorello's has recaptured its reputation as a special Italian restaurant!
Danny (the chef/owner) has really zeroed in on quality and its consistency. Everything on the menu is quite good...BUT their pizza is the best. There aren't many pizzas even in NYC that can compare to Fiorello's pies! If you've never had a pizza cooked in a wood-fired oven, get ready; you're in for a real treat. The pizza can also be carefully packaged for take out. The staff is always pleasant and eager to serve. [14 Dec 2006 19:06:31]

Overrated The food was good, service was horrible. The lady making the pizza actually had to be our waiter because they were so unorganized. It was very busy and they could not handle it. There wasnt a waiting list, didn't get menus when we sat down, had to ask for a waiter after 15 minutes of waiting. The food wasn't worth the price, the pizza was good to get for takeout ( good recommendation to get take out pizza), other than that don't go there on Fri night or Sat night. Even people with reservations had to wait for a table. [02 Mar 2008 19:57:12]
